Columbia, Mo vs Maturin Climate & Distance Between

Venezuela flag
  • The distance between Columbia, Mo, Usa and Maturin, Venezuela is approximately 4,332 km or 2,692 mi.
  • To reach Columbia, Mo in this distance one would set out from Maturin bearing 323°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Columbia, Mo bearing 310.5° or NW .
  • Columbia, Mo has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Maturin has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• Columbia, Mo is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Maturin is in or near the tropical dry forest bi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 13.9 °C (25°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 26 °C (46.8°F) more in Columbia, Mo.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 344.3 mm (13.6 in) less which is equivalent to 344.3 l/m² (8.45 US gal/ft²) or 3,443,000 l/ha (368,080 US gal/ac) less. About 3/4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 22.4° lower in Columbia, Mo than in Maturin.
